发明名称 FUEL INJECTION CONTROL DEVICE FOR CYLINDER INJECTION INTERNAL COMBUSTION ENGINE
摘要 PROBLEM TO BE SOLVED: To reduce torque shock, by exactly adjusting engine torque in switching of two combustion modes of a stratified charge combustion mode of a lean air-fuel ratio and a homogeneous combustion mode of a rich air-fuel ratio, in a cylinder injection internal combustion engine operated by switching between the stratified charge combustion mode and homogeneous combustion mode. SOLUTION: For example, in switching from the stratified charge combustion mode to the homogeneous combustion mode, a throttle valve 20 is closed by a predetermined amount before switching the the fuel injection mode (time t2 and t3). An amount of increase in pumping loss along with the close operation of the valve is detected based on a signal or the like from an intake pressure sensor 21, and an amount of decrease in combustion efficiency or the like caused by enrichment of an air-fuel ratio A/F is detected, and a fuel injection amount is corrected to be increased so as to cancel out the decrease in engine toque along with the increase in pumping loss and the enrichment of the air-fuel ratio (t2 to t4). The fuel injection mode is switched from compression stroke injection to intake stroke injection, and ignition retard is performed corresponding to a jump of the air-fuel ratio along with the switching (t4 or after), so that rapid increase in engine torque immediately after the switching of injection modes is canceled out.
